As Neko said, the chances are quite slim- especially if the woman has access to proper medical treatment with trained professionals.
However, the chances of death are considerably higher without these. Depending on how bad the conditions are, it can nearly be a 1 in 4 chance, due to increased risk of infection, blood loss, etc.
A woman of weak constitution will definitely be at higher risk.
Not sure about the depression thing. If it does have an effect, I don't believe it's by any measurable amount.
